Transaction 8d21636df8bd7181e4a825ec291d24325adedaefed4f5504aad91de352850495

1 Input
2 Outputs
  • 8d21636df8bd7181e4a825ec291d24325adedaefed4f5504aad91de352850495:0
  • value  849646739
    address  32doJfNMriFr75wJyL2dMkgB2yF5FR2y1d
  • 8d21636df8bd7181e4a825ec291d24325adedaefed4f5504aad91de352850495:1
  • value  350224
    address  3H9sFpdsTdR5DmNMwyzTavbfw7CbT2Hc4n